THE SACRAMENT OF BAPTISM

Baptism is the first of the seven sacraments, and the “door” which gives access to the other sacraments. Baptism is the first and chief sacrament of forgiveness of sins because it unites us with Christ, who died for our sins and rose for our justification. The rite of Baptism consists in immersing the candidate in water, or pouring water on the head, while pronouncing the invocation of the Most Holy Trinity: the Father, the Son, and the Holy Spirit.

Baptisms at St. Patricks are offered in both English or Latin by appointment. The guidelines for having a child Baptized at St. Patrick’s are:

  • Complete and submit the St. Patrick’s Baptismal Registration Form, the Parental Testimonial Form and the Godparent Testimonial Form. Please note that a signed form must be received for both Godparents. These forms should be filled out and returned as soon as possible.
  • For Non-Parishioners, a permission letter must be obtained from you the Pastor of your home Parish, delegating St. Patrick’s Permission to perform the Baptism.
  • Both the Parents and Godparents must attend a Baptismal Seminar conducted by a Priest or Deacon of the Catholic Church. A letter must be sent from the Priest or Deacon conducting the seminar, proving attendance.
  • All selected Godparents must be Confirmed practicing Catholics over the age of 18. Only one Godparent is required. If you have only one Godparent, you may select a second person to participate as a Christian Witness as long as the person selected has been Baptized in another Christian Faith.
  • If a Priest or Deacon from outside the Archdiocese of New Orleans is going to perform the Baptism, a letter of good standing from their home Diocese is required.
  • The fee for Baptism’s at St. Patrick’s are:
    • English – Parishioner $100 Suggested Donation, Non-Parishioner $200 required.
    • Latin – Parishioner $200 Required, Non-Parishioner $300 required.
    • In addition to the Baptism Fee, there is a $200-dollar stipend requirement for the Priest or Deacon performing the Baptism.
  • All paperwork must be submitted, and all fees must be paid prior to the scheduling of any Baptism.
